Transaction 135728ded6bf558fcf6fa52043566b53197a356afca575e12ec20eb564750748
1 Input
1 Output
-
135728ded6bf558fcf6fa52043566b53197a356afca575e12ec20eb564750748: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 86cd041b9e79b081836c3a275e7fba1f591c48d7c389644bef27e7b91a8e0ed3
- address
- bc1psmxsgxu70xcgrqmv8gn4ula6rav3cjxhcwykgjl0ylnmjx5wpmfsnxfhum